for when we were in the flesh, the passions of the sins, that [are] through the law, were working in our members, to bear fruit to the death;

and now we have ceased from the law, that being dead in which we were held, so that we may serve in newness of spirit, and not in oldness of letter.

What, then, shall we say? the law [is] sin? let it not be! but the sin I did not know except through law, for also the covetousness I had not known if the law had not said:

`Thou shalt not covet;' and the sin having received an opportunity, through the command, did work in me all covetousness -- for apart from law sin is dead.

And I was alive apart from law once, and the command having come, the sin revived, and I died;

10 and the command that [is] for life, this was found by me for death;

11 for the sin, having received an opportunity, through the command, did deceive me, and through it did slay [me];

12 so that the law, indeed, [is] holy, and the command holy, and righteous, and good.
